About G. Zhuang
G. Zhuang is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Aerospace Engineering, having authored 253 papers that have together received 2.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Magnetic confinement fusion research (229 papers), Ionosphere and magnetosphere dynamics (112 papers) and Superconducting Materials and Applications (73 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Nuclear and High Energy Physics (2.1k citations), Astronomy and Astrophysics (1.1k citations) and Aerospace Engineering (661 citations). G. Zhuang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Qiming Hu, Yonghua Ding, Li Gao, Bo Rao, Zhoujun Yang, Ming Zhang, Q. Yu, J. Chen, V. S. Chan and Kexun Yu.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Computational Physics, Physics Letters A and Review of Scientific Instruments.
